要把写好的模块传到板子上去,本来打算用NFS启动然后insmod,结果发现QQ2440似乎有个bug:NFS下的模块文件无法加载,于是只好想办法通过串口传。
这才想起这样一个东西:lrzxz,好像是unix时代很常见的一个工具,aptitude install之后,弄了半天终于知道怎么用了。
下面一部分摘自他人blog 稍有改动
minicom下向板子传输方法:
# minicom
(Ctrl + a) --> s --> zmodem --> [Okay] -->
+-----------------------------------------+
|No file selected - enter filename: |
|> /选择要传输的文件 | [Enter]
+-----------------------------------------+
配置lrzxz:
--------------------------------------------------
Ctrl + a o
+-----[configuration]------+
| Filenames and paths |
| File transfer protocols -|
| Serial port setup |
| Modem and dialing |
| Screen and keyboard |
| Save setup as dfl |
| Save setup as.. |
| Exit |
+--------------------------+
+-----------------------------------------------------------------------+
| A - Download directory :
/home/gm/lrzxz-rx |
| B - Upload directory :
/home/gm/lrzxz-tx |
| C - Script directory : |
| D - Script program : runscript |
| E - Kermit program : |
| F - Logging options |
| |
| Change which setting? |
+-----------------------------------------------------------------------+
A - download 下载的文件的存放位置
B - upload 从此处读取上传的文件
download 开发板 ---> PC
upload PC ---> 开发板
B - Upload directory :
PC机向开发板发送文件,需要发送的文件在/home/gm/lrzxz-tx目录下。做了此项配置后,每次向开发板发送文件时,只需输入文件名即可,无需输入文件所在目录的绝对路径
开发板 ---> PC
--------------------------------------------------
开发板上的(操作)命令
# sz filename
开发板上的文件filename将被传输到PC机上/home/gm/lrzxz-rx目录下
阅读(9311) | 评论(0) | 转发(0) |